This document outlines the Russian Studies program offered at the Choate School for Boys in Connecticut.Context
The Cold War encouraged schools across the United States to become proficient in academics. The Choate School identifies that "one of the greatest needs of our country today is for specialists in every field and language." A knowledge of Russian history and language might have seemed advantageous for the Choate School administrators who created the program.Collection
